2012-02-28 |
Evan Cheng | Re-commit r151623 with fix. Only issue special no-retur... |
tree | commitdiff |
2012-02-28 |
Daniel Dunbar | Revert r151623 "Some ARM implementaions, e.g. A-series... |
tree | commitdiff |
2012-02-28 |
Evan Cheng | Some ARM implementaions, e.g. A-series, does return... |
tree | commitdiff |
2012-02-28 |
Michael J. Spencer | [Object] Add {begin,end}_dynamic_symbols stubs and... |
tree | commitdiff |
2012-02-27 |
Michael J. Spencer | Remove duplicate copy of Object/ELF.h that somehow... |
tree | commitdiff |
2012-02-27 |
Jim Grosbach | ARM BL/BLX instruction fixups should use relocations. |
tree | commitdiff |
2012-02-27 |
Argyrios Kyrtzidis | Move "clang/Analysis/Support/SaveAndRestore.h" to ... |
tree | commitdiff |
2012-02-27 |
Derek Schuff | Fix PR12089 |
tree | commitdiff |
2012-02-27 |
Jakob Stoklund Olesen | Add a MachineOperand iterator class. |
tree | commitdiff |
2012-02-27 |
Jay Foad | Help the compiler to eliminate some dead code when... |
tree | commitdiff |
2012-02-26 |
Rafael Espindola | Change the implementation of dominates(inst, inst)... |
tree | commitdiff |
2012-02-26 |
Rafael Espindola | Don't call dominates on unreachable instructions. |
tree | commitdiff |
2012-02-25 |
Nick Lewycky | Move isKnownNonNull from private implementation detail... |
tree | commitdiff |
2012-02-25 |
Chad Rosier | Add support for disabling llvm.lifetime intrinsics... |
tree | commitdiff |
2012-02-23 |
Benjamin Kramer | Replace a DenseSet with SmallPtrSet. |
tree | commitdiff |
2012-02-23 |
Benjamin Kramer | Strip a layer of boilerplate from the VLIWPacketizer... |
tree | commitdiff |
2012-02-23 |
Jay Foad | The implementation of GeneralHash::addBits broke C... |
tree | commitdiff |
2012-02-23 |
Craig Topper | Remove 'if' from getSuperRegisters, getSubRegisters... |
tree | commitdiff |
2012-02-23 |
Duncan Sands | GCC warns about a comparison between signed and unsigne... |
tree | commitdiff |
2012-02-23 |
Andrew Trick | PostRASched: Convert physreg def/use tracking to Jakob... |
tree | commitdiff |
2012-02-23 |
Jakob Stoklund Olesen | Track reserved registers separately from RegsAvailable. |
tree | commitdiff |
2012-02-22 |
Hal Finkel | Allow the use of an alternate symbol for calculating... |
tree | commitdiff |
2012-02-22 |
Michael J. Spencer | Properly emit _fltused with FastISel. Refactor to share... |
tree | commitdiff |
2012-02-22 |
David Greene | Add Foreach Loop |
tree | commitdiff |
2012-02-22 |
Jakob Stoklund Olesen | Fix typos. |
tree | commitdiff |
2012-02-22 |
Chandler Carruth | Support was removed from LLVM's MIPS backend for the... |
tree | commitdiff |
2012-02-22 |
Andrew Trick | Initialize SUnits before DAG building. |
tree | commitdiff |
2012-02-22 |
Craig Topper | Make all pointers to TargetRegisterClass const since... |
tree | commitdiff |
2012-02-22 |
NAKAMURA Takumi | ADT/SparseSet.h: Fix up header dependencies. |
tree | commitdiff |
2012-02-22 |
Jakob Stoklund Olesen | Add a Briggs and Torczon sparse set implementation. |
tree | commitdiff |
2012-02-21 |
Lang Hames | Add API "handleMoveIntoBundl" for updating liveness... |
tree | commitdiff |
2012-02-21 |
Chandler Carruth | Pull the parsing helper functions out of the Triple... |
tree | commitdiff |
2012-02-21 |
Chandler Carruth | Clean up comments that I missed when changing the tripl... |
tree | commitdiff |
2012-02-21 |
Craig Topper | Reorder some members in MCRegisterClass to remove paddi... |
tree | commitdiff |
2012-02-21 |
Craig Topper | In generated RegisterInfo files, replace a pointer... |
tree | commitdiff |
2012-02-21 |
Craig Topper | Merge some tables in generated RegisterInfo file. Store... |
tree | commitdiff |
2012-02-21 |
Andrew Trick | Clear virtual registers after they are no longer refere... |
tree | commitdiff |
2012-02-21 |
Andrew Trick | whitespace |
tree | commitdiff |
2012-02-21 |
Chandler Carruth | Switch the llvm::Triple class to immediately parse... |
tree | commitdiff |
2012-02-20 |
Eric Christopher | Add support for runtime languages on our forward declar... |
tree | commitdiff |
2012-02-20 |
James Molloy | Improve generated code for extending loads and some... |
tree | commitdiff |
2012-02-20 |
Chandler Carruth | Move constructors out-of-line and flesh out their docum... |
tree | commitdiff |
2012-02-19 |
Ahmed Charles | Remove dead code. Improve llvm_unreachable text. Simpli... |
tree | commitdiff |
2012-02-19 |
Ahmed Charles | StringRef'ize EmitSourceFileHeader(). |
tree | commitdiff |
2012-02-18 |
Talin | Hashing.h - utilities for hashing various data types. |
tree | commitdiff |
2012-02-17 |
Jakob Stoklund Olesen | Transfer regmasks to MRI. |
tree | commitdiff |
2012-02-17 |
Dan Gohman | Calls and invokes with the new clang.arc.no_objc_arc_ex... |
tree | commitdiff |
2012-02-17 |
Lang Hames | Refactor 'handleMove' code in live intervals. Clients... |
tree | commitdiff |
2012-02-17 |
David Chisnall | Generate the correct EH frame section types on Solaris... |
tree | commitdiff |
2012-02-17 |
David Chisnall | Revert r150814. It turns out that there is a good... |
tree | commitdiff |
2012-02-17 |
Richard Osborne | Fix typo in comment. |
tree | commitdiff |
2012-02-17 |
David Chisnall | Don't lazily allocate eh_frame. We're not lazily alloc... |
tree | commitdiff |
2012-02-16 |
Bill Wendling | s/ModAttrBehavior/ModFlagBehavior/g to be consistent... |
tree | commitdiff |
2012-02-16 |
Pete Cooper | Template specialize SmallVector::push_back based on... |
tree | commitdiff |
2012-02-15 |
Andrew Trick | Fix library visibility problems with VLIWPacketizer. |
tree | commitdiff |
2012-02-15 |
Bill Wendling | Use the enum instead of 'unsigned'. |
tree | commitdiff |
2012-02-15 |
Lang Hames | Make LiveIntervals::handleMove() bundle aware. |
tree | commitdiff |
2012-02-15 |
Bill Wendling | Modify the code that emits the module flags to use... |
tree | commitdiff |
2012-02-15 |
Bill Wendling | Add a module flags accessor method which returns the... |
tree | commitdiff |
2012-02-15 |
Kaelyn Uhrain | Add function for computing the edit distance of two... |
tree | commitdiff |
2012-02-15 |
Andrew Trick | Don't expose DefaultVLIWScheduler |
tree | commitdiff |
2012-02-15 |
Andrew Trick | Generic "VLIW" packetizer based on a DFA generated... |
tree | commitdiff |
2012-02-15 |
Eric Christopher | Add a way to replace a field inside a metadata node... |
tree | commitdiff |
2012-02-15 |
Lang Hames | Add a check to make sure we don't assign slot indexes... |
tree | commitdiff |
2012-02-15 |
Andrew Trick | Allow CodeGen (llc) command line options to work as... |
tree | commitdiff |
2012-02-15 |
Andrew Trick | Added TargetPassConfig::disablePass/substitutePass... |
tree | commitdiff |
2012-02-15 |
Andrew Trick | comment |
tree | commitdiff |
2012-02-15 |
Lang Hames | Disentangle moving a machine instr from updating LiveIn... |
tree | commitdiff |
2012-02-14 |
Jakob Stoklund Olesen | Handle regmasks in findRegisterDefOperandIdx(). |
tree | commitdiff |
2012-02-14 |
Dmitri Gribenko | Silence the new -Wempty-body warning. It appeared... |
tree | commitdiff |
2012-02-14 |
Bill Wendling | Add code to the target lowering object file module... |
tree | commitdiff |
2012-02-14 |
Lang Hames | Tighten physical register invariants: Allocatable physi... |
tree | commitdiff |
2012-02-14 |
Lang Hames | Rename getExceptionAddressRegister() to getExceptionPoi... |
tree | commitdiff |
2012-02-13 |
Kostya Serebryany | ThreadSanitizer, a race detector. First LLVM commit. |
tree | commitdiff |
2012-02-13 |
Owen Anderson | v2f16 is a floating point type. Add symbolic floating... |
tree | commitdiff |
2012-02-13 |
Dylan Noblesmith | add LLVM_VERSION_MAJOR and _MINOR defines |
tree | commitdiff |
2012-02-13 |
Ahmed Charles | Fix various issues (or do cleanups) found by enabling... |
tree | commitdiff |
2012-02-12 |
Eli Bendersky | Expose the ELFObjectFile class directly in the Object... |
tree | commitdiff |
2012-02-12 |
Nick Lewycky | Remove redundant getAnalysis<> calls in GlobalOpt.... |
tree | commitdiff |
2012-02-11 |
Anton Korobeynikov | Add support for implicit TLS model used with MS VC... |
tree | commitdiff |
2012-02-11 |
Benjamin Kramer | Make the EDis tables const. |
tree | commitdiff |
2012-02-11 |
Bill Wendling | [WIP] Initial code for module flags. |
tree | commitdiff |
2012-02-11 |
Andrew Trick | Add TargetPassConfig hooks for scheduling/bundling. |
tree | commitdiff |
2012-02-11 |
Andrew Trick | comment |
tree | commitdiff |
2012-02-10 |
Jakob Stoklund Olesen | Clean up comment. |
tree | commitdiff |
2012-02-10 |
Jakob Stoklund Olesen | Add a static MachineOperand::clobbersPhysReg(). |
tree | commitdiff |
2012-02-10 |
Hal Finkel | Make aliasesPointer and aliasesUnknownInst public membe... |
tree | commitdiff |
2012-02-10 |
Duncan Sands | Revert commit 149912 (lattner) and add a testcase that... |
tree | commitdiff |
2012-02-10 |
Benjamin Kramer | Put instruction names into an indexed string table... |
tree | commitdiff |
2012-02-10 |
Andrew Trick | RegAlloc superpass: includes phi elimination, coalescin... |
tree | commitdiff |
2012-02-10 |
Lang Hames | Remove unused 'isAlias' parameter. |
tree | commitdiff |
2012-02-10 |
Jakob Stoklund Olesen | Cache basic block boundaries for faster RegMaskSlots... |
tree | commitdiff |
2012-02-10 |
Jakob Stoklund Olesen | Optimize LiveIntervals::intervalIsInOneMBB(). |
tree | commitdiff |
2012-02-09 |
David Blaikie | Change default error_code ctor to a 'named ctor' so... |
tree | commitdiff |
2012-02-09 |
Benjamin Kramer | Store just the SimpleValueType in the generated VT... |
tree | commitdiff |
2012-02-09 |
Benjamin Kramer | Move the Name field in MCInstrDesc to the end, saving... |
tree | commitdiff |
2012-02-09 |
Andrew Trick | Improve TargetPassConfig. No intended functionality. |
tree | commitdiff |
2012-02-08 |
Andrew Trick | Codegen pass definition cleanup. No functionality. |
tree | commitdiff |
2012-02-08 |
Andrew Trick | Move pass configuration out of pass constructors: Machi... |
tree | commitdiff |
2012-02-08 |
Andrew Trick | Move pass configuration out of pass constructors: Stack... |
tree | commitdiff |
next |